Hi Jaimin, Is your allwinner a20 processor listed under the list of Processors(Soc) mentioned in the list of AOSP(android Open Source kernel) kernels here : (under Figuring out which kernel to build : )
-> http://source.android.com/source/building-kernels.html#figuring-out-which-kernel-to-build DeviceBinary locationSource locationBuild configurationshamu device/moto/shamu-kernelkernel/msmshamu_defconfigfugudevice/asus/fugu-kernel kernel/x86_64fugu_defconfigvolantisdevice/htc/flounder-kernelkernel/tegra flounder_defconfighammerheaddevice/lge/hammerhead-kernelkernel/msm hammerhead_defconfigflodevice/asus/flo-kernel/kernelkernel/msmflo_defconfig debdevice/asus/flo-kernel/kernelkernel/msmflo_defconfigmanta device/samsung/manta/kernelkernel/exynosmanta_defconfigmako device/lge/mako-kernel/kernelkernel/msmmako_defconfiggrouper device/asus/grouper/kernelkernel/tegrategra3_android_defconfigtilapia device/asus/grouper/kernelkernel/tegrategra3_android_defconfigmaguro device/samsung/tuna/kernelkernel/omaptuna_defconfigtoro device/samsung/tuna/kernelkernel/omaptuna_defconfigpanda device/ti/panda/kernelkernel/omappanda_defconfigstingray device/moto/wingray/kernelkernel/tegrastingray_defconfigwingray device/moto/wingray/kernelkernel/tegrastingray_defconfigcrespo device/samsung/crespo/kernelkernel/samsungherring_defconfigcrespo4g device/samsung/crespo/kernelkernel/samsungherring_defconfig If it is there it is fairly easy to start the porting process : As a summary these will be the steps : 1.Download the Android source (start with Kitkat : 4.4.4 ) and build it , follow : http://source.android.com/source/building-running.html 2.Download the kernel source for your board and build it. follow : http://source.android.com/source/building-kernels.html 3.Link the zImage of the kernel built in #2 at arch/<processor-type>/boot/zImage (use ln -s <location of zImage> kernel) 4.Build the Android as whole or build the bootimage - make bootimage 5.Now in the device/<manufacture>/<device-name>/ there must be a README to flash the board you have using fastboot. 6.Using #5 Use the images formed in the out/target/product/<your device name> - system.img ,boot.img and userdata.img as formed after #4 (for all images ) to flash your board. 7.Connect your Board with the HDMI cable to a Display screen and connect it using USB cable for USB adb debugging. You can connect the minicom to get the output while your board boots(kernel) up by connecting RS232-to-USB cable with your board . If you find any issue post the logs here .
